External Audit
External auditors
The AGM in 2010 re-elected PricewaterhouseCoopers AB (PwC) as the Group’s external auditors for a four-year period, until the AGM in 2014. Authorized Public Accountant Anders Lundin is the auditor in charge of Electrolux.
PwC provides an audit opinion regarding AB Electrolux, the financial statements of its subsidiaries, the consolidated financial statements for the Electrolux Group and the administration of AB Electrolux. The auditors also conduct a review of the report for the third quarter.
The audit is conducted in accordance with the Swedish Companies Act, International Standards on Auditing (ISA) and generally accepted auditing standards in Sweden.
Audits of local statutory financial statements for legal entities outside of Sweden are performed as required by law or applicable regulations in the respective countries and as required by IFAC GAAS, including issuance of audit opinions for the various legal entities.

Fees to auditors
SEKm | 2011 | 2012 | 2013 |
---|---|---|---|
PwC |
|
|
|
Audit fees | 44 | 44 | 44 |
Audit-related fees | 4 | 1 | 2 |
Tax fees | 5 | 4 | 5 |
All other fees | 6 | 4 | 2 |
Total fees to PwC | 59 | 53 | 53 |
Audit fees to other audit firms | – | 2 | 2 |
Total fees to auditors | 59 | 55 | 55 |

Financial Reporting
Net sales for the Electrolux Group in 2013 amounted to SEK 109,151m, as against SEK 109,994m in the previous year. The organic sales growth was 4.5%, while currencies had an impact of -5.3%.
